i am using an n800 with os2008.
there is something i unknowingly did that removed the left search pane or any other way to type in a word.
i finally removed tha app, shutdown n800, restarted and re-installed goldendict.
i still get single pane only. is there a configuration file i need to delete or modify via linux?

or is there someway thru app to bring back my two panes?

Yes -- right-click somewhere on the menu bar area and check 'Search Pane' there.

petrosi,

tap and hold in the same area that has icons (print, save, sound, zoom, etc.) More specifically, to the right of those icons where there is empty space. You'll see two options: Search Pane and Navigation. I've tested this on my N810 and it works. Good luck.
